Santa came to town this Christmas.

For a year which was so-so for many Nigerians, music artistes decided to lift our spirits by giving us at least three memorable concerts week after week. For us, this has been a good kind-of-crazy.

In the midst of all these, we have chosen our top five drama-filled concerts that generated a lot of buzz this Christmas holiday.

30BillionConcert

Davido is officially our baby boy of the week and deservedly so. His stellar performance, support for the streets by giving upcoming artistes a chance to showcase their music to the public and bringing back Mo’Hits to perform on stage, songs that made our youth tick, put a smile on our faces. The concert also made history by becoming the highest grossing concert ever in Nigeria. Talk about greatness in one night.

WizkidTheConcert

Nigerians have not been this happy about people reuniting in a long time. Ojuelegba crooner, Wizkid and Omo baba olowo, Davido gave us a reason to scream in excitement this holiday and it was worth it. These former frenemies got on the same stage to perform Davido’s single, FIA to give us an electrifying presentation.

One Night Stand

A few Nigerian artistes can flow with a live band effectively. The easy-going Adekunle Gold owned the stage and the band with his performance. In a captivating moment that lasted a few minutes, a fan thought of no better time to propose to his girlfriend than after Adekunle’s Orente rendition. Luckily, his Sade said yes.

OLIC4

They don’t call Olamide the king of the streets for nothing. Free meals, blocked roads, 2500 uniformed men, Lagos State Government support, spectacular performances, massive fan turn up and huge publicity, OLIC4 was lit!

Hennessy Artistry

Falz literally came through in a [vintage] mercedes, Ycee was introduced by a mascot of dancers, Olamide pulled the roof down and Timaya, got everyone grooving without a care in the world. This is not to mention Hennessy cocktail blends that went round as the audience listened to throwback hit songs from Dj Neptune and Dj Consequence. Now, that’s Swag.
